At its offices in Gloucestershire, CEMAR’s desire was to create flexible space in a large ground-floor meeting room as part of a refurbishment project. In doing so they would have greater flexibility to divide the area into two separate meeting rooms, or open it up for larger gatherings, presentations and as a general break out space.

A core challenge, however, was that there was no structure in the ceiling for the folding wall system, and some lateral thinking was required to find a solution.

As a result, a Stylefold 120 folding wall system was chosen as this was the only operable wall that could realistically accommodate the room structure.

To install the Stylefold 120, a non-structural timber frame was created for lateral support and the weight of the folding wall was transferred to the floor via a surface mounted floor track.

The ability to do this is unique to Stylefold, offering Style Partitions yet another point of difference.

“We’re very proud of our ability to work with clients to overcome complications in room structure and design, and develop a solution that works perfectly for them,” said Julian Sargent, Style’s group managing director.

“On this occasion, we had excellent dialogue with CEMAR who organised for the timber frame to be built enabling us to install the folding wall using a floor track, rather than the traditional ceiling track.

“The final installation not only complements the room’s interior design with a white melamine finish, but also offers 46dB Rw acoustic integrity and a pass door for room access when the wall is in place.”
